Ok, pecking is simple - here is a chunk of my code from Vectric, it drills a hole at X0 Y0 to 4.5mm deep with a rapid retract to +0.5mm each peck.
N100 G00 G21 G17 G90 G40 G49 G80
N110 G71 G91.1
N120 T2 M06
N130 (T2 - 5mm Carbide YG)
N140 G00 G43 Z20.000 H2
N150 G00 Z20.000
N160 S12500 M03
N170 M07
N180 (Toolpath:- Drill 1)
N190 ()
N200 G94
N210 F550.0
N220 G00 X0 Y0 Z20.000
N230 G00 X0 Y0 Z2.000
N240 G01 X0 Y0 Z-1.500 F300.0
N250 G00 X0 Y0 Z0.500
N260 G01 X0 Y0 Z-3.000 F300.0
N270 G00 X0 Y0 Z0.500
N280 G01 X0 Y0 Z-4.500 F300.0
N290 G00 X0 Y0 Z20.000
N300 G53 G0 Z0.000
N310 M05
N320 M09
N330 G54
N340 M30
Obviously you need to feed in your speeds and feeds.
This code is more of a deep-hole full-retract type drilling, for a simple chip-breaker, modify the retract lines to just pull the Z back up maybe 0.5mm from the last cut depth, this maybe enough to break the stringers, may need a little more retract.
